To dress up the donut on this card, I started by sponging Saddle ink over the Cashmere paper cut donut, putting a little more at the edge than in the center. I cut the “glaze” out of the striped vellum paper in the Uptown Fundamentals paper pack. I colored on the back side with the Tender Pink ShinHan marker before gluing it to the donut with Liquid Glass. (The color was too intense, so I removed some with a cotton ball wetted with Rubbing Alcohol.) I used more Liquid Glass over the top and, before it dried, added tiny snips of white paper to create sprinkles.
With this card, I used the largest flower from the Here for You WYW (featured last week) to create a swirl of white “frosting” over the clear “glaze.” I did the everything the same as above except I didn’t color the back of the vellum, and I embossed the swirl with white powder before adding Liquid Glass over the top.
